    Assuming the ounces per vertical meter remain the same as they go deeper , diminishing returns are occurring , as :
    the cost to drill gets higher the deeper they go
    the date that ore is extracted from deeper down could be 6 years away
    expense to mine ore from deeper down increases

    Flip side as you allude to is if the mineralisation from NN somehow joins up with West Winds at depth , that would be a game changer , and agree shallower mineralisation from West Winds and Sly fox means ore to fill the mill to capacity , it also allows mining on several fronts/headings which reduces risk .
    SO maybe that is where they should be concentrate drilling on later ?
